Подскажите пожалуйста, как в одном доменном имени установить различные версии WordPress`a?
к примеру:
domainname.com/ru/wordpress/
domainname.com/en/wordpress/
domainname.com/de/wordpress/
domainname.com/by/wordpress/
domainname.com/bg/wordpress/
domainname.com/ua/wordpress/
… это нужно чтобы в одном доменном имени присутствовали различные версии WP с различными языковыми настройками для тестирования плагина…
Попробовал на локалке испытать подобное, выдает ошибку, что сервер недоступен.
Поиск на форуме не дал результатов.
Может быть кто знает, где какие настройки нужны?
загружаете по копии ВП в папки: /ru/wordpress/, /en/wordpress/, /de/wordpress/ и так далее и устанавливаете ВП как обычно.
не свосем понятно зачем папку wordpress вкладывать в папки ru, en, de/…. , но дело хозяйское.
можно и в одном ВП переключаться между языками легко, в папку wp-includes/languages/ загружаете языковые файлы, которые находите тут:
http://codex.wordpress.org/WordPress_in_Your_Language
а в wp-config.php меняете
define (‘WPLANG’, ‘ru_RU’);
на
define (‘WPLANG’, ‘de_DE’);
и т.п.
… пробовал использовать языки в одной папке, в итоге Вавилон получился с плагинами, которые используют свои уникальные языковые настройки. К тому же большая часть публикуемых материалов для каждого языка своя, и не повторяется в других языках (лишь некоторые материалы повторяются в переводе). Принял решение, для каждого языка использовать wordpress на "родных" переводах. То есть, лучше уж возиться с каждым сайтом отдельно, чем ломать голову, когда "всё в одном". Раньше использовал поддомены для каждого языка отдельно, но их поисковики просто не индексировали. Подсказали, сделай всё на одном домене в поддиректориях. Так лучше будет для индексации. (только сайтмап надо будет немного подправить ручками)
Кстати, установил всё как обычно. Получилось с третьего раза. (не знаю, в чем была причина)
Вроде бы пока что работает… Далее видно будет!
Но, всё равно спасибо за ответы.